WORCESTER__ Viola M. (Girard) Daoust, 96, formerly of 86 Plantation St. passed away at Christopher House on Sunday, August 6. Her husband, Wilfred O. Daoust died in 1990.
She is survived by a son Paul G. Daoust and his wife Sandra of Millbury; two daughters, Madeline C. Pawloski and her husband Royce of Oakland, MI, and Elaine R. Brissette and her husband Donald of Worcester; 9 grandchildren, 14 great-grandchildren and several nieces and nephews. Viola was born in Worcester, a daughter of William and Aldea (Boucher) Girard and lived on Grafton Hill all her life.
Mrs Daoust graduated from the former Commerce High School. She was a life long member of St. Joseph’s Church, and its Ladies of Ste Anne Sodality and was a member of the Women’s Club and First Friday Club. She was a volunteer at Saint Francis Home for many years. Viola was also a volunteer at St. Vincent Hospital where she received accolades for her service. She spent a great deal of time making clothes for newborns.
